# Insurance Renewal — Managers Only

Policy with Tarnwell Mutual expires end of Q2. Premium quote up 9%; broker says market-wide. Coverage unchanged except cyber rider, now mandatory. Delmar Finch handled negotiations last cycle; his notes are in the shared drive. Incoming director should approve renewal or request competing quotes from Ashgrove Underwriting by the 15th. No claims outstanding. Context on why this matters for our plans is noted below.

internal memo for bahap-yagug: Headcount on the Ulaix team goes from 3 to 100 by the end of January. Gross margin on Ulaix came in at 10 percent against a plan of 15 percent.

Subject: Quick heads-up on the Vantrell situation

Team,

As some of you have heard, we've opened preliminary talks with Vantrell Logistics about a possible acquisition. Their cold-chain network would plug a big gap in our Marovia coverage, and their founder, Dalen Crowe, seems genuinely open to a deal. Finance, please start pulling together a rough valuation range before Thursday's sync — nothing polished, just directional. Keep this tight for now; we don't want chatter reaching their other suitors. Here's the part that stays in this room:

internal memo for hahif-hahaf: Headcount on the Zorwyn team goes from 9 to 100 by the end of October. Gross margin on Zorwyn came in at 5 percent against a plan of 10 percent.

## Ownership

Fabrikker is the shared test-data factory library used across Norrow services. Reviewers: reject PRs that add service-specific fixtures here; those belong downstream. Factory defaults must stay deterministic — seed changes require a changelog entry. Breaking changes to trait names need a deprecation cycle of one release. Sign-off on any public API change comes from the maintainer listed below.

account owner for kafop-haweg: Pelax Gilael Istir

Handover Note — Corvane Supply Renewal

Hi team — passing the Corvane contract over to Marissa as I move to the Delwick office. Renewal is due end of quarter; they'll push for a 6% uplift, but we have leverage given the missed delivery windows in spring. Keep the tone friendly, they're a good partner. Background on why this renewal matters strategically is noted below.

board note of baweg-bawig: Project Tamath slips by six weeks because of the audit delay.